Expert Review

Amazon's Warehouse Associate positions offer flexibility with both part-time and full-time options. With a signing bonus and benefits for families, it's an attractive choice for many. However, the fast-paced environment can be challenging. Workers often report high stress levels due to the demanding nature of the job.

If you're considering this role, know that it requires a lot of physical activity and quick problem-solving skills. Many workers appreciate the decent pay rates, but the work can be relentless, especially during peak seasons like holidays. According to Amazon's site, benefits extend to family members, which is a plus for many employees.

Overall, this position suits those looking for quick pay and who can handle the pressures of a busy warehouse environment. Just don't expect a cushy gig — it's hard work, and the turnover is notable. For more details, check Amazon's job postings directly.
